INA8583
Description
INA8583N contains 256х8 RAM 8-bit. The word address register which is incre-
mented automatically, built-in 32.768 kHz oscillator circuit, frequency divider, interface of
two line bi-directional serial I2C-bus and power-on reset circuit.
The first 8 bits of the RAM (addresses 00÷07) are designated ass addressable 8-bit
parallel registers. The first register (address 00) is used as a control/status register. The
memory addresses 01 to 07 are used as counters for the clock function. The memory ad-
dress 08÷0F may be used as free RAM locations or may be programmed as alarm regis-
ters.
The following modes can be selected by setting the control/status register:
Clock mode from 32.768 kHz;
Clock mode from 50 Hz;
Event counter mode.
In the clock mode hundredths of a second, seconds, minutes, hours, date, month
(four-year calendar) and a weekday are stored in a BCD format. The timer register stores
up to 99 days. The event counter mode is used for counting pulses applied to the oscilla-
tor input (OSCO left open-circuit). In BCD format the event counter stores up to 6 digits.
By setting the alarm enabling bit of the control/status register the alarm control regis-
ter (address 08) is activated.
By setting the alarm control register the following may be programmed:
Dated alarm;
Weekday alarm;
Daily alarm;
Timer alarm.
In the clock mode the timer register (address 07) may be programmed to count hun-
dredths of a second, seconds, minutes, hours or days. Days are counted when an alarm is
not programmed.
Whenever an alarm event occurs the alarm flag of the control/status register is set,
and an overflow condition of the timer will set the timer flag. The open drain interrupt out-
put is switched on (active LOW) when the alarm or timer flag is set. The flags remain set
until directly reset by a write operation to register (00 address).
When the alarm is disabled the remaining alarm registers (addresses 09÷0F) may be
used as free RAM.
In the clock modes 24hr or 12hr format can be selected by setting the most signifi-
cant bit of the hours counter register.
